"Frontier Communications is going to see its contact center requirements double this year. As a result, we needed a way to deliver an advanced contact center solution that could scale rapidly in a very short amount of time. The Avaya Pod Fx gave us all the advanced contact center features that we needed -- multichannel, IVR, workforce optimization, Avaya Breeze, in a scalable, full stack, turnkey solution that will reduce our costs by 25% over our previous appliance-based model and reduce internal IT effort and expense through integrated management and support."
Kelly Morgan, SVP and GM, Frontier Secure and Contact Center
